The abundance of atp gene transcript and of the membrane F1F0-ATPase as a function of the growth pH of alkaliphilic Bacillus firmus OF4.

D M Ivey1, M G Sturr, T A Krulwich, D B Hicks.   

Abstract

Molecular biological and biochemical studies of the F(1)F(0)-ATP synthase of alkaliphilic Bacillus firmus OF4 show that the enzyme used at pH 7.5 and pH 10.5 is a unique product of the atp operon, expressed at the same levels and yielding an enzyme with the same subunit properties and c-subunit/holoenzyme stoichiometry.
